This book explains the basic components and taxonomy of UAS that are vulnerable to cyber influence. It explores the hostile use and Cyber-Vulnerabilities of UAS: Components, Autonomy vs., Automation, Performance Trade-offs, SCADA and Cyber Attack Taxonomy. This text will provide an effective learning experience and become a referenced resource for students and professionals working to secure the national airspace and reduce known and unknown threats with this developing technology. The book is useful for UAS operators, pilots, and ground personnel, owners and computer network analysts to manage the workloads associated with each phase of flight in any service: military, commercial, or recreational.
